Abstract

PURPOSE:To provide a corrosion preventive material for metals having the effect better than that of conventional molybdic acid corrosion preventive materials by contg. polymaleic acid (salt) and molybdic acid (salt) or tungstic acid (salt) as effective components. CONSTITUTION:A corrosion preventive material contg. two components of polymaleic acid or its salt (e.g.; Li salt) of usually about 500-2,000mol. wts. (A) and molybdic acid or its salt (e.g.; Li salt) or tungstic acid or its salt (e.g. Li salt) (B) as effective components. Ratios by weight of the component A and component B of this case are 1:0.5-5.0, more particularly 1:0.5-2.5. This corrosion preventive material for metals is suited for use usually in the form of an aq. soln. or by preparing in the form of powder directly mixed therewith. If this corrosion preventive material is added usually at about 2.0-100ppm as the total amt. of the effective components to the system to be prevented of corrosion, the purpose is achieved.
